Autor |
Nachricht |
sascha_kote
Threadersteller
Dabei seit: 18.10.2007
Ort: Münster
Alter: -
Geschlecht:
|
Verfasst Di 22.05.2012 09:50
Titel eingebundene seite (iframe) per css gestalten |
|
|
halllo,
ich versuche eine mobile.de seite per iframe einzubinden und möchte lediglich die schriftgröße der mobile.de seite kleinermachen.
in der css steht nur:
Code: |
body {
font-size: 6px;
font-family: "Helvetica Neue", helvetica, sans-serif;
background: #fff;
}
|
Code: |
<iframe width='770' scrolling='yes' height='429' frameborder='0' align='top' src='http://home.mobile.de/home/homepageAllVehiclesSearch.html?scopeId=AV&sr_qual=EGN&sort=2&language=de&&customerId=12345&partnerHead=false&css=http://www.ccc.de/test.css' name='iframe' id='blockrandom'></iframe>
|
jemand ne ahnung wie ich das am besten bewerkstelligen kann?
die einbindung muss leider per iframe erfolgen.
sascha
|
|
|
|
|
phihochzwei
Moderator
Dabei seit: 08.06.2006
Ort: Mülheim an der Ruhr
Alter: 46
Geschlecht:
|
Verfasst Di 22.05.2012 10:13
Titel
|
|
|
Also du willst eine fremde Seite, auf die du keinen direkten Zugriff hast, per iframe in deine Seite einbinden und deren Inhalt manipulieren ?
|
|
|
|
|
Anzeige
|
|
|
ChrisKam
Dabei seit: 01.07.2009
Ort: Hattingen
Alter: 38
Geschlecht:
|
Verfasst Di 22.05.2012 12:52
Titel
|
|
|
Ja, das möchte er wohl und dafür bietet mobile.de auch extra die Möglichkeit an, ein Stylesheet zu übergeben. Sehe das Problem darin nicht so wirklich - mobile.de sieht das wohl auch kaum als "Manipulation" an, sonst würden sie die Möglichkeit mit &css= nicht einräumen.
Sascha - am besten du installierst Dir mal Firefox und Firebug und versuchst herauszufinden, ob das CSS überhaupt korrekt eingebunden ist und ob deine Schriftgröße nicht durch irgendwas überschrieben wird (z.B. durch ein Element, was näher am Text dran ist als <body>)
edit: ansonsten kannst du mal
body{
font-size: 6px!important;
}
versuchen.
Zuletzt bearbeitet von ChrisKam am Di 22.05.2012 12:52, insgesamt 1-mal bearbeitet
|
|
|
|
|
phihochzwei
Moderator
Dabei seit: 08.06.2006
Ort: Mülheim an der Ruhr
Alter: 46
Geschlecht:
|
Verfasst Di 22.05.2012 13:40
Titel
|
|
|
Wenn du denen ein Stylesheet übergeben kannst geht das, nur wenn du die Möglichkeit nicht hast, geht´s nicht.
|
|
|
|
|
choise
Dabei seit: 01.02.2007
Ort: Würzburg
Alter: 35
Geschlecht:
|
Verfasst Di 22.05.2012 14:43
Titel
|
|
|
früher ging das mal, zumindest hatte ichs schonmal gemacht.
zauberwort ist hier javascript, bin mir allerdings nicht sicher, ob das mit html5 zb noch geht, also ob das DOM-Model das noch zulässt.
hier mal n link: http://stackoverflow.com/questions/217776/how-to-apply-css-to-iframe
allerdings ist das mehr als schlecht. vorallem weil man erstmal auf dom-loaded warten sollte bis man das neue css includiert und es somit zu einem flackern kommt, wenn es von dem alten layout aufs neue switched.
|
|
|
|
|
immerIch
Dabei seit: 19.10.2010
Ort: #mein{display:block}
Alter: 35
Geschlecht:
|
Verfasst Di 22.05.2012 15:31
Titel
|
|
|
choise hat geschrieben: | früher ging das mal, zumindest hatte ichs schonmal gemacht.
zauberwort ist hier javascript, bin mir allerdings nicht sicher, ob das mit html5 zb noch geht, also ob das DOM-Model das noch zulässt.
|
Nein, und mit Javascript dürfte das auch so noch nie funktioniert haben, Stichwort "same origin policy".
|
|
|
|
|
ChrisKam
Dabei seit: 01.07.2009
Ort: Hattingen
Alter: 38
Geschlecht:
|
Verfasst Di 22.05.2012 15:58
Titel
|
|
|
Der "korrekte" Weg wäre ohnehin eine Anbindung an die mobile.de API -> http://services.mobile.de/
Irgendwie bezweifele ich aber, dass der TO dazu die Möglichkeiten hat, wenn eine Iframe Lösung akzeptabel gewesen wäre
|
|
|
|
|
|
|
|
Ähnliche Themen |
Seite neu laden, iFrame aber nicht?
mitlaufende Iframe Werbung auf Seite mit CSS realisieren
element in iframe (fremde seite) anpsrechen
Wie / womit diese Seite gestalten?
Anker in einem iframe von separater Seite aus ansprechen
Zu Iframe verlinken ohne Seite ganz neu zu laden
|
|